Diagnostic Tests for Occipitotemporal Sulcus Degeneration:

Diagnosing occipitotemporal sulcus degeneration typically involves a combination of history-taking, physical examinations, and specialized tests, including:

  1. Medical history: Gathering information about the patient’s symptoms, medical history, and family history of neurological conditions.
  2. Neurological examination: Assessing reflexes, coordination, sensation, and cognitive function.
  3. Magnetic resonance imaging (MRI): Produces detailed images of the brain to detect structural abnormalities.
  4. Computed tomography (CT) scan: Provides cross-sectional images of the brain to identify any lesions or abnormalities.
  5. Positron emission tomography (PET) scan: Measures brain activity and metabolism to detect changes indicative of degeneration.
  6. Cerebrospinal fluid analysis: Examining the fluid surrounding the brain and spinal cord for markers of neurodegenerative disease.
  7. Electroencephalogram (EEG): Records electrical activity in the brain to detect abnormalities associated with seizures or other neurological conditions.
  8. Neuropsychological testing: Evaluates cognitive function, memory, attention, and language skills.
  9. Genetic testing: Identifies specific gene mutations associated with hereditary forms of degeneration.
  10. Blood tests: Checks for signs of infection, inflammation, or metabolic abnormalities.

Medications for Occipitotemporal Sulcus Degeneration:

While medications cannot reverse occipitotemporal sulcus degeneration, they may help manage specific symptoms and complications associated with the condition:

  1. Cholinesterase inhibitors: Improve cognitive function and alleviate symptoms of memory loss and confusion in some individuals.
  2. Memantine: Modulates glutamate activity in the brain to improve cognitive function and behavior.
  3. Antidepressants: Address mood disturbances such as depression or anxiety.
  4. Antipsychotics: Manage hallucinations, delusions, or agitation in individuals with severe behavioral symptoms.
  5. Anxiolytics: Reduce anxiety and promote relaxation.
  6. Sleep aids: Improve sleep quality and address insomnia or sleep disturbances.
  7. Anticonvulsants: Control seizures in individuals with epilepsy or seizure disorders.
  8. Dopamine agonists: Alleviate motor symptoms such as tremors or rigidity in Parkinson’s disease.
  9. Vasodilators: Increase blood flow to the brain and improve cognitive function in some cases.
  10. Neuroprotective agents: Slow the progression of degeneration and protect brain cells from further damage.
